Quickly go from 2D array to bitmap?

Hey all,

 

Is there a fast way to go from a 2D-Array to a bitmap image? Right now I'm going from 2D Array -> Draw Unflattened Pixmap.vi -> Picture to Pixmap.vi -> Write BMP File.vi, and it's taking way longer to than it seems like should be necessary.

 

Anyone have any suggestions?

 

Thanks in advance for your assistance.
